It’s generally agreed that authenticity, the self-aware practice of attempting to live by one’s values, is a good thing. The concept, however, also exists in presenting yourself as real. It’s not only about being in your true life, it’s also demonstrating that you’re doing so. However genuine you are, if you come across as a fake, you won’t be trusted. And in a society made up of human connections, faith in others is key. These days, authenticity is more than an admirable trait. When it comes to presenting your public face to the world, it’s an imperative. From social media posts to business speak, the art of promotion relies on being, and appearing, 100 per cent oneself.
